DRAKE RELAYS 2017
T
he time has come again to plan one of
Drake University's largest traditions. This
is also a time to remember our chapter
history and all our achievements. We welcome
everyone back to celebrate the 68th anniversary
of Gamma Tau at the Drake Relays. Below is an
estimated weekend schedule. We will send out
more information as this is finalized.
Friday, April 28
8-10 p.m. Alumni Welcome Reception at the
Chapter House
Saturday, April 29
9-10:30 a.m. QC Building Corporation Meeting
10:30-11:30 a.m. Undergraduates/Alumni
Networking Round Tables
11:30 a.m.-12:30 p.m. Alumni Barbecue Lunch
12:30-2 p.m. Room Dedication Ceremony* and
Senior Send-Off
2-5 p.m. Alumni/Legal-Aged Undergraduates
Alpine Lounge Field Trip
9 p.m.-12 a.m. Relays Celebration
Please contact Adam Graves '16 at agraves2012@
gmail.com if you have any questions or would like
to help with planning.
*We are excited to recognize all of those who have
donated their time and resources to help make the
chapter what it is today. Individuals who donated
$25,000 or more will be recognized at our room
dedication ceremony.
